Catalytic Dehydrative Transformations Mediated by Moisture-Tolerant Zirconocene Triflate

Abstract [en]

Zirconocene triflate is a powerful moisture-tolerant catalyst for activation of C O bonds in carboxylic acids and alcohols in the absence of water scavenging techniques. Herein, an overview of the use of this robust metal complex for direct amidation, esterification, and etherification is presented, along with a discussion on mechanistic aspects of the transformations and the catalyst class.
